Storm Lake Municipal Airport (IATA: SLB, ICAO: KSLB, FAA LID: SLB) is a city-owned public-use airport located in Storm Lake, Iowa, United States.[1] The airport is mostly used for general aviation.
Facilities and aircraft
Storm Lake Municipal Airport covers an area of 160 acres (65 ha) and contains one turf runway (06/24: 1,962 x 95 ft) and two concrete runways (13/31: 3,035 x 50 ft and 17/35: 5,002 x 75 ft). For the 12-month period ending May 7, 2009, the airport had 19,600 aircraft operations for an average of 54 per day. There are 37 aircraft based at this airport: 36 single-engine and 1 jet.[1]
